Bewilder

By (Uncredited)

The board for the game consists of a plastic tray with nine compartments arranged in a 3x3 grid for holding the playing cards. The cards have either a blue circle or a green circle on them. To start the game, the cards are dealt into the tray, alternating blue and green on each row (i.e. Row 1: B,G,B; Row 2: G,B,G; Row 3: B,G,B). The first player has to attempt to change the color pattern of the cards to 9 Blue Cards in exactly 9 moves. S/He may pick any card from any compartment and place it into any other compartment. this counts as one move. S/He may not take two cards from the same compartment consecutively OR place two cards into the same compartment consecutively. After s/he completes nine movers his/her turn is over. For each card s/he has changed to blue, s/he scores one point. If all nine cards are the correct color, an additional nine points are scored. The next player then attempts to do the same thing with the color opposite of the one used by the preceding player. The first player to 100 points is the winner.
